Paris: About the Hiring Process

Qualified candidates interested in a career or an internship in our Paris office are welcome to send by e-mail or regular mail a cover letter and their curriculum vitae to the attention of the Paris Recruiting Department Assistant.

Selected applicants will be invited for interviews with one or more partners and/or associates in Paris. The process may involve several rounds of interviews. Decisions to recruit interns or permanent associates for the Paris office are taken by the Paris Personnel Committee on the basis of the academic and, if applicable, professional achievements of the applicants and their evaluation by partners and/or associates who interviewed them.

The firm participates in a number of events organized in France by law schools (Paris I, Paris II, Paris X, etc.), business schools (HEC, ESSEC, ESCP-EAP, etc.), political sciences schools (Instituts d'études politiques) and other academic institutions to provide students with information on the firm and the career opportunities it offers. Typically, the purpose of these events is informational only and students wishing to apply for a permanent position or an internship must apply separately to the Paris Office Hiring Partner.

The firm also participates in the job fair sponsored by the Paris Bar School (Ecole Française du Barreau) where we meet a number of job applicants each year.

Furthermore, the firm participates each year in the New York University International Student Interview Program and the Columbia Overseas-Trained LL.M. Student Interview Program held at the end of January in New York for applicants enrolled in LL.M. programs in the United States. In addition to hiring applicants from these interview programs to begin work directly as associates in the Paris office, we also invite selected students to participate in our International Lawyer Program in New York or Washington before transferring to the Paris office.
